| |
|
|
| |
已解决
|
|
| |
如何增加和减少数据库的字段 |
|
|
|
|
|
我在用Pardox数据库编程时,需要在程序运行中按操作为数据表增加或减少字段,应如何做。我使用过Sql中的Alter table命令但不能达到目的。
|
|
|
如果有了满意的回答请及时采纳,不要辜负了回答者!
|
|
|
|
|
|
|
|
|
|
|
最佳答案 
回答者:Tom(Tom) 级别:沙场军衔-中校 (2006-12-07 17:57:00) |
|
由于Pardox数据库不支持SELECT ...INTO...语句,最直接的方法就是用SQL语句的ALTER TABLE命令了。增加和减少字段的操作分别如下:
1. ALTER TABLE yourtable ADD COLUMN newcolumn VARCHAR(10)
2. ALTER TABLE yourtable DROP yourcolumn
另,如果是把查询出来的数据存放到新表的话,可以分两步实现:
1. CREATE TABLE newtable(field1 VARCHAR(10),field2 NUMBER)
2. INSERT INTO newtable(field1 ,field2) SELECT fielda,fieldb FROM youtable
|
| |
| |
提问者对答案的评价:
|
| |
| |
谢谢哈!!
|
|
|
|
|
| 提问者请及时处理问题 |
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
| 公告区 |
 |
|
|
|
|
|
|
|
 |
|
|
|
|
|